南开本部20春学期(2003)《并行程序设计》在线作业-2 作者:周老师 分类: 南开大学 发布时间: 2020-04-18 16:22 专业辅导各院校在线、离线考核、形考、终极考核、统考、社会调查报告、毕业论文写作交流等! 联系我们:QQ客服:3326650399 439328128 微信客服①:cs80188 微信客服②:cs80189 扫一扫添加我为好友 扫一扫添加我为好友 奥鹏作业答案 联系QQ:3326650399 微信:cs80188 【熊猫奥鹏】-[南开大学(本部)]20春学期(1709、1803、1809、1903、1909、2003)《并行程序设计》在线作业 试卷总分:100 得分:100 第1题,n个数求和的串行程序,经过一个循环将每个数累加到大局变量sum中,其多线程版别简略将循环规模改动为每个线程负载的规模,存在的疑问是____。 A、负载不均 B、通讯开支大 C、CPU闲暇等候严峻 D、sum累加发生竞赛条件,致使成果过错 正确答案: 第2题,选用区分子矩阵方法完成矩阵乘法,在进行SSE并行化时,是对(由表及里数)第____层循环进行循环打开然后向量化。 A、3 B、4 C、5 D、6 正确答案: 第3题,OpenMP是___的一个常见代替。 A、SSE B、MPI C、Pthread D、CUDA 正确答案: 第4题,选用区分子矩阵技术优化矩阵乘法CUDA程序,首要思想是访存更多在____。 A、CPU内存 B、GPU显存 C、GPU同享内存 D、GPU存放器 正确答案: 第5题,pthread_rwlock_wrlock是对读写锁进行____操作。 A、加锁 B、解锁 C、加读琐 D、加写锁 正确答案: 第6题,SSE数据移动指令分类不包含____。 A、对齐传输 B、未对齐传输 C、标量传输 D、缓存传输 正确答案: 第7题,SSE intrinsics _mm_load_pd指令的功用是____。 A、对齐向量读取单精度浮点数 B、未对齐向量读取单精度浮点数 C、对齐向量读取双精度浮点数 D、未对齐向量读取双精度浮点数 正确答案: 第8题,每个SSE存放器宽度为____位。 A、32 B、64 C、128 D、256 正确答案: 第9题,我国初次取得戈登?贝尔奖是在____年。 A、2015 B、2016 C、2017 D、2018 正确答案: 第10题,FORTRAN语言存储二维数组采纳____。 A、行主次第存储 B、列主次第存储 C、交织式存储 D、对角线存储 正确答案: 第11题,关于科学仿真并行计算的一般方法,哪个过程的描绘是过错的? A、将空间离散化为网格 B、在网络进步行部分计算 C、部分计算成果彻底独立 D、重复若干时刻步 正确答案: 第12题,当时CPU功能提高已从依靠时钟频率提高转为更多依靠____。 A、多核和众核技术 B、打破物理限制 C、改进散热 D、选用新资料 正确答案: 第13题,我国近来一次夺得全球超级计算机计算才能冠军的是____。 A、银河1号 B、银河1A C、银河2号 D、威风.太湖之光 正确答案: 第14题,对矩阵乘法串行程序主体三重循环的最内层循环进行向量化,则该循环履行结束后,就计算出了断果矩阵的一个元素,这种说法是____。 A、正确的 B、过错的 正确答案: 第15题,MPI组通讯操作不包含哪类____。 A、通讯 B、同步 C、点对点 D、计算 正确答案: 第16题,对一个串行程序进行SIMD并行化,应要点思考的程序有些是____。 A、声明句子 B、条件分支句子 C、循环句子 D、输入输出句子 正确答案: 第17题,在运用互斥量之后有必要对其进行____。 A、初始化 B、加锁 C、解锁 D、毁掉 正确答案: 第18题,____履行pthread_sem_post操作,当时线程会唤醒堵塞线程。 A、当信号量已加锁时 B、当信号量为0时 C、当信号量已超越阈值时 D、当信号量已毁掉时 正确答案: 第19题,一个AVX存放器最多寄存____个双精度浮点数。 A、2 B、4 C、8 D、16 正确答案: 第20题,OpenMP不会自动地在____方位设置barrier。 A、并行结构开端 B、并行结构完毕 C、其他操控结构开端 D、其他操控结构完毕 正确答案: 第21题,关于妨碍机制,下面说法过错的是____。 A、会致使疾速线程堵塞,不该运用 B、在需求强行线程步骤共同时,应运用 C、可用互斥量机制完成 D、归于一种组通讯 正确答案: 第22题,动态线程编程形式的缺陷是____。 A、线程管理开支高 B、系统资源使用率低 C、线程使命分配艰难 D、线程通讯功率低 正确答案: 第23题,使命依靠图中极点权重之和表明____。 A、使命数 B、使命难度 C、串行履行时刻 D、并行履行时刻 正确答案: 第24题,编写矩阵乘法的AVX程序,若矩阵元素为单精度浮点数,则应对矩阵乘—加计算的循环进行____路循环打开。 A、2 B、4 C、8 D、16 正确答案: 第25题,CUDA的长处不包含____。 A、可移植性 B、入门简略 C、规范的SPMD形式 D、不再需求图形API 正确答案: 第26题,为了完成向量计算,SIMD架构还需供给____。 A、更大的内存容量 B、更快的内存传输 C、更宽的存放器 D、更快的网络传输 正确答案: 第27题,主线程经过____函数获取特定线程的回来成果。 A、pthread_create B、pthread_join C、pthread_cancel D、pthread_get 正确答案: 第28题,n个数求和的疑问,运用n个处理器的并行算法到达了logn的运转时刻,则算法____。 A、必定不是价值最优 B、必定是价值最优 C、不断定是不是价值最优 D、以上皆错 正确答案: 第29题,为避免编译器不撑持OpenMP,应运用____完成OpenMP代码和普通代码的条件编译。 A、"#include " B、"#pragma omp parallel" C、"#ifdef _OPENMP" D、"#define _OPENMP" 正确答案: 第30题,在运用条件变量之前有必要对其进行____。 A、初始化 B、加锁 C、解锁 D、毁掉 正确答案: 第31题,选用MPI主从模型处理矩阵每行排序疑问,主进程每次向一个从进程发送10行作为一个使命相关于每次发送1行的长处是____。 A、更有利于负载均衡 B、削减了通讯开支 C、下降了计算次数 D、削减了从进程闲暇 正确答案: 第32题,以下超级计算机中,____是SIMD架构。 A、CRAY-1 B、银河1A C、银河2号 D、威风.太湖之光 正确答案: 第33题,对区分输入数据的战略,下面说法过错的是____。 A、当输出数据很少时,需区分输入数据 B、当输出数据存在依靠时,需区分输入数据 C、一般最终需求汇总成果 D、因为不是直接区分输出数据,功能会很差 正确答案: 第34题,完成任何时间都只要一个线程进行同享变量更新的OpenMP指令是____。 A、omp parallel B、omp barrier C、omp critical D、omp reduce 正确答案: 第35题,for (i=2; i10; i++) A[i] = A[i-2]+1; 此循环____数据依靠。 A、存在 B、不存在 C、不断定 D、以上皆错 正确答案: 第36题,SSE intrinsics _mm_hadd_ps指令的功用是____。 A、存放器间单精度浮点数向量加法 B、存放器间双精度浮点数向量加法 C、存放器内单精度浮点数加法 D、存放器内双精度浮点数加法 正确答案: 第37题,一个Neon存放器最多寄存____个双精度浮点数。 A、2 B、4 C、8 D、16 正确答案: 第38题,关于并行价值,下面描绘正确的是____。 A、老是小于串行时刻 B、老是大于并行时刻 C、老是与并行时刻渐进持平 D、以上皆错 正确答案: 第39题,在运用条件变量之后有必要对其进行____。 A、初始化 B、加锁 C、解锁 D、毁掉 正确答案: 第40题,下列哪门课程不是并行程序设计的先导课? A、计算机概论 B、高级语言程序设计 C、计算机体系结构 D、数据库系统 正确答案: 第41题,CPU cache巨细为32KB,64*64的两个矩阵进行加法计算,下面说法正确的是____。 A、可使用cache时刻部分性优化功能 B、可使用cache空间部分性优化功能 C、可经过矩阵分片优化功能 D、访存方面无优化能够 正确答案: 第42题,记并行时刻为T,串行时刻为T\',处理器数量为p,并行价值的界说是____。 A、pT B、T\'+T C、p(T\'-T) D、pT-T\' 正确答案: 第43题,每个AVX存放器宽度为____位。 A、32 B、64 C、128 D、256 正确答案: 第44题,弹性性的意义不包含____。 A、硬件能晋级拓展 B、扩展系统规划结构成本增加不快 C、程序在新硬件下仍能高效运转 D、程序在更大规划系统下仍能高效运转 正确答案: 第45题,静态线程编程形式的缺陷是____。 A、线程管理开支高 B、系统资源使用率低 C、线程负载不均 D、线程通讯开支高 正确答案: 第46题,OpenMP循环并行指令是____。 A、omp parallel B、omp single C、omp parallel for D、omp master 正确答案: 第47题,对单精度浮点计算,SSE最高完成____路并行。 A、2 B、4 C、8 D、16 正确答案: 第48题,MMX有____个专用存放器。 A、4 B、8 C、16 D、32 正确答案: 第49题,在MPI中从/向虚拟进程收/发音讯的实践作用是____。 A、与通讯域根进程通讯 B、与0号进程通讯 C、像啥都没发作相同 D、以上皆错 正确答案: 第50题,1) R=XR*1.3;G=XG*1.8;B=XB*1.1; 2) R=X[0]*1.3;G=X[1]*1.8;B=X[2]*1.1; 这两个程序片段哪个进行向量化功率更高? A、1) B、2) C、不断定 D、以上皆错 正确答案: 奥鹏作业答案 联系QQ:3326650399 微信:cs80188 2003(751)本部(1051)南开(5584)春(11118)学期(8554) 专业辅导各院校在线、离线考核、形考、终极考核、统考、社会调查报告、毕业论文写作交流等!(非免费) 联系我们:QQ客服:3326650399 439328128 微信客服①:cs80188 微信客服②:cs80189 扫一扫添加我为好友 扫一扫添加我为好友
【熊猫奥鹏】-[南开大学(本部)]20春学期(1709、1803、1809、1903、1909、2003)《并行程序设计》在线作业
试卷总分:100 得分:100
第1题,n个数求和的串行程序,经过一个循环将每个数累加到大局变量sum中,其多线程版别简略将循环规模改动为每个线程负载的规模,存在的疑问是____。
A、负载不均
B、通讯开支大
C、CPU闲暇等候严峻
D、sum累加发生竞赛条件,致使成果过错
正确答案:
第2题,选用区分子矩阵方法完成矩阵乘法,在进行SSE并行化时,是对(由表及里数)第____层循环进行循环打开然后向量化。
A、3
B、4
C、5
D、6
正确答案:
第3题,OpenMP是___的一个常见代替。
A、SSE
B、MPI
C、Pthread
D、CUDA
正确答案:
第4题,选用区分子矩阵技术优化矩阵乘法CUDA程序,首要思想是访存更多在____。
A、CPU内存
B、GPU显存
C、GPU同享内存
D、GPU存放器
正确答案:
第5题,pthread_rwlock_wrlock是对读写锁进行____操作。
A、加锁
B、解锁
C、加读琐
D、加写锁
正确答案:
第6题,SSE数据移动指令分类不包含____。
A、对齐传输
B、未对齐传输
C、标量传输
D、缓存传输
正确答案:
第7题,SSE intrinsics _mm_load_pd指令的功用是____。
A、对齐向量读取单精度浮点数
B、未对齐向量读取单精度浮点数
C、对齐向量读取双精度浮点数
D、未对齐向量读取双精度浮点数
正确答案:
第8题,每个SSE存放器宽度为____位。
A、32
B、64
C、128
D、256
正确答案:
第9题,我国初次取得戈登?贝尔奖是在____年。
A、2015
B、2016
C、2017
D、2018
正确答案:
第10题,FORTRAN语言存储二维数组采纳____。
A、行主次第存储
B、列主次第存储
C、交织式存储
D、对角线存储
正确答案:
第11题,关于科学仿真并行计算的一般方法,哪个过程的描绘是过错的?
A、将空间离散化为网格
B、在网络进步行部分计算
C、部分计算成果彻底独立
D、重复若干时刻步
正确答案:
第12题,当时CPU功能提高已从依靠时钟频率提高转为更多依靠____。
A、多核和众核技术
B、打破物理限制
C、改进散热
D、选用新资料
正确答案:
第13题,我国近来一次夺得全球超级计算机计算才能冠军的是____。
A、银河1号
B、银河1A
C、银河2号
D、威风.太湖之光
正确答案:
第14题,对矩阵乘法串行程序主体三重循环的最内层循环进行向量化,则该循环履行结束后,就计算出了断果矩阵的一个元素,这种说法是____。
A、正确的
B、过错的
正确答案:
第15题,MPI组通讯操作不包含哪类____。
A、通讯
B、同步
C、点对点
D、计算
正确答案:
第16题,对一个串行程序进行SIMD并行化,应要点思考的程序有些是____。
A、声明句子
B、条件分支句子
C、循环句子
D、输入输出句子
正确答案:
第17题,在运用互斥量之后有必要对其进行____。
A、初始化
B、加锁
C、解锁
D、毁掉
正确答案:
第18题,____履行pthread_sem_post操作,当时线程会唤醒堵塞线程。
A、当信号量已加锁时
B、当信号量为0时
C、当信号量已超越阈值时
D、当信号量已毁掉时
正确答案:
第19题,一个AVX存放器最多寄存____个双精度浮点数。
A、2
B、4
C、8
D、16
正确答案:
第20题,OpenMP不会自动地在____方位设置barrier。
A、并行结构开端
B、并行结构完毕
C、其他操控结构开端
D、其他操控结构完毕
正确答案:
第21题,关于妨碍机制,下面说法过错的是____。
A、会致使疾速线程堵塞,不该运用
B、在需求强行线程步骤共同时,应运用
C、可用互斥量机制完成
D、归于一种组通讯
正确答案:
第22题,动态线程编程形式的缺陷是____。
A、线程管理开支高
B、系统资源使用率低
C、线程使命分配艰难
D、线程通讯功率低
正确答案:
第23题,使命依靠图中极点权重之和表明____。
A、使命数
B、使命难度
C、串行履行时刻
D、并行履行时刻
正确答案:
第24题,编写矩阵乘法的AVX程序,若矩阵元素为单精度浮点数,则应对矩阵乘—加计算的循环进行____路循环打开。
A、2
B、4
C、8
D、16
正确答案:
第25题,CUDA的长处不包含____。
A、可移植性
B、入门简略
C、规范的SPMD形式
D、不再需求图形API
正确答案:
第26题,为了完成向量计算,SIMD架构还需供给____。
A、更大的内存容量
B、更快的内存传输
C、更宽的存放器
D、更快的网络传输
正确答案:
第27题,主线程经过____函数获取特定线程的回来成果。
A、pthread_create
B、pthread_join
C、pthread_cancel
D、pthread_get
正确答案:
第28题,n个数求和的疑问,运用n个处理器的并行算法到达了logn的运转时刻,则算法____。
A、必定不是价值最优
B、必定是价值最优
C、不断定是不是价值最优
D、以上皆错
正确答案:
第29题,为避免编译器不撑持OpenMP,应运用____完成OpenMP代码和普通代码的条件编译。
A、"#include "
B、"#pragma omp parallel"
C、"#ifdef _OPENMP"
D、"#define _OPENMP"
正确答案:
第30题,在运用条件变量之前有必要对其进行____。
A、初始化
B、加锁
C、解锁
D、毁掉
正确答案:
第31题,选用MPI主从模型处理矩阵每行排序疑问,主进程每次向一个从进程发送10行作为一个使命相关于每次发送1行的长处是____。
A、更有利于负载均衡
B、削减了通讯开支
C、下降了计算次数
D、削减了从进程闲暇
正确答案:
第32题,以下超级计算机中,____是SIMD架构。
A、CRAY-1
B、银河1A
C、银河2号
D、威风.太湖之光
正确答案:
第33题,对区分输入数据的战略,下面说法过错的是____。
A、当输出数据很少时,需区分输入数据
B、当输出数据存在依靠时,需区分输入数据
C、一般最终需求汇总成果
D、因为不是直接区分输出数据,功能会很差
正确答案:
第34题,完成任何时间都只要一个线程进行同享变量更新的OpenMP指令是____。
A、omp parallel
B、omp barrier
C、omp critical
D、omp reduce
正确答案:
第35题,for (i=2; i10; i++) A[i] = A[i-2]+1; 此循环____数据依靠。
A、存在
B、不存在
C、不断定
D、以上皆错
正确答案:
第36题,SSE intrinsics _mm_hadd_ps指令的功用是____。
A、存放器间单精度浮点数向量加法
B、存放器间双精度浮点数向量加法
C、存放器内单精度浮点数加法
D、存放器内双精度浮点数加法
正确答案:
第37题,一个Neon存放器最多寄存____个双精度浮点数。
A、2
B、4
C、8
D、16
正确答案:
第38题,关于并行价值,下面描绘正确的是____。
A、老是小于串行时刻
B、老是大于并行时刻
C、老是与并行时刻渐进持平
D、以上皆错
正确答案:
第39题,在运用条件变量之后有必要对其进行____。
A、初始化
B、加锁
C、解锁
D、毁掉
正确答案:
第40题,下列哪门课程不是并行程序设计的先导课?
A、计算机概论
B、高级语言程序设计
C、计算机体系结构
D、数据库系统
正确答案:
第41题,CPU cache巨细为32KB,64*64的两个矩阵进行加法计算,下面说法正确的是____。
A、可使用cache时刻部分性优化功能
B、可使用cache空间部分性优化功能
C、可经过矩阵分片优化功能
D、访存方面无优化能够
正确答案:
第42题,记并行时刻为T,串行时刻为T\',处理器数量为p,并行价值的界说是____。
A、pT
B、T\'+T
C、p(T\'-T)
D、pT-T\'
正确答案:
第43题,每个AVX存放器宽度为____位。
A、32
B、64
C、128
D、256
正确答案:
第44题,弹性性的意义不包含____。
A、硬件能晋级拓展
B、扩展系统规划结构成本增加不快
C、程序在新硬件下仍能高效运转
D、程序在更大规划系统下仍能高效运转
正确答案:
第45题,静态线程编程形式的缺陷是____。
A、线程管理开支高
B、系统资源使用率低
C、线程负载不均
D、线程通讯开支高
正确答案:
第46题,OpenMP循环并行指令是____。
A、omp parallel
B、omp single
C、omp parallel for
D、omp master
正确答案:
第47题,对单精度浮点计算,SSE最高完成____路并行。
A、2
B、4
C、8
D、16
正确答案:
第48题,MMX有____个专用存放器。
A、4
B、8
C、16
D、32
正确答案:
第49题,在MPI中从/向虚拟进程收/发音讯的实践作用是____。
A、与通讯域根进程通讯
B、与0号进程通讯
C、像啥都没发作相同
D、以上皆错
正确答案:
第50题,1) R=XR*1.3;G=XG*1.8;B=XB*1.1; 2) R=X[0]*1.3;G=X[1]*1.8;B=X[2]*1.1; 这两个程序片段哪个进行向量化功率更高?
A、1)
B、2)
C、不断定
D、以上皆错
正确答案:
奥鹏作业答案 联系QQ:3326650399 微信:cs80188
专业辅导各院校在线、离线考核、形考、终极考核、统考、社会调查报告、毕业论文写作交流等!(非免费)
联系我们:QQ客服:3326650399 439328128 微信客服①:cs80188 微信客服②:cs80189
扫一扫添加我为好友 扫一扫添加我为好友